10. Chris Jericho Forgot That WCW Nitro Was On TNT

Chris Jericho's final appearance on WCW Monday Nitro happened on the 5 April 1999 episode. There, in a United States Title Tournament semi, the soon-to-be 'Y2J' lost to Booker T in less than four minutes. After that, Jericho's WCW run consisted of house show jobs, and he was never on TNT prime time again.

Until now.

AEW's deal with the network means Jericho's career is coming full circle. On his 'Talk Is Jericho' podcast, he admitted to forgetting that Nitro was ever on the station at all. When he figured it out one day, Jericho was ecstatic that he'd be returning to the scene of the crime a full 20 years after last being on the air.

There is something cool about all this. When Jericho inevitably wrestles on AEW television, it'll be almost two decades to the day that he last worked on TNT against Booker. Way to make history, maaaaaaaaaan. Sorry, just had to get that in.
